Description

This position supports a multi-functional Finance Operations team with responsibilities across Accounts Payable (AP), Accounts Receivable (AR), Treasury, and Risk Management.

Manager, Finance Shared Services

Key Responsibilities

  • Champion process improvements within AP and AR functions and help standardize financial workflows across departments.
  • Conduct detailed cash flow reporting and analysis to support improved forecasting and financial planning.
  • Work with cross-functional teams to ensure timely and accurate reporting of financial performance metrics.
  • Identify opportunities for system optimization to support data integrity and operational scalability.
  • Evaluate operational risks, develop appropriate mitigation strategies, and support implementation of internal controls.
  • Assist with risk and insurance management activities including data gathering, tracking, and reporting.

Qualification & Requirements

QUALIFICATIONS & EXPERIENCE

  • Chartered Professional Accountant (CPA) designation or equivalent
  • 5–8 years of progressive experience in finance, accounting, or shared services roles.
  • Track record of success in systems implementation and operational process improvements.
  • Experience with large data sets
  • Familiarity with ESG frameworks and reporting best practices.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office and experience using ERP systems (e.g., Navision, Microsoft Dynamics, or similar platforms).

KEY SKILLS

  • Strong analytical thinking with a structured approach to problem-solving.
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ills for cross-team collaboration.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ple projects and meet tight deadlines.
  • Comfortable presenting data-driven insights in a clear and actionable way.
